Deep Dive
1. Purpose & Architecture
Avalanche was built to solve the blockchain trilemma of achieving scalability, security, and decentralization simultaneously. Its value proposition is enabling fast, low-cost, and customizable networks. The platform uses a novel consensus mechanism—Avalanche Consensus—which enables sub-second transaction finality and can process over 4,500 transactions per second.
2. Subnet Technology & Three-Chain System
The ecosystem's standout feature is its subnet architecture. Developers can launch dedicated, customizable Layer-1 blockchains (subnets) with their own rules and validators. These subnets benefit from the main network's security but avoid congestion, making them ideal for specific use cases like gaming or enterprise finance.
This is supported by a tri-chain structure:
- X-Chain (Exchange Chain): Creates and trades digital assets.
- C-Chain (Contract Chain): Hosts Ethereum-compatible smart contracts, allowing developers to use tools like Solidity and MetaMask.
- P-Chain (Platform Chain): Coordinates validators, enables staking, and creates/manages subnets.
3. Ecosystem & Institutional Adoption
Avalanche's ecosystem has expanded significantly into decentralized finance (DeFi), gaming, and notably, real-world asset (RWA) tokenization. Its speed and subnet flexibility have made it a preferred choice for institutions. Major adoptions include JPMorgan's Evergreen subnet for portfolio management, BlackRock's tokenized fund, and government projects like digitizing millions of vehicle titles in California.
